Method
Braised Short Rib
Prepare the Short Ribs
Season the short ribs with salt and black pepper.
Braise the Ribs
Add beef broth, thyme, and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for about 2-3 hours until the ribs are tender and easily pulled apart.
Pasta
Cook the Pasta
In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add cavatappi p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Mushrooms & Spinach
Sauté the Vegetables
In a separate skillet, sauté the mushrooms over medium heat until they are browned, about 5-7 minutes. Add the fresh spinach and sun-dried tomatoes, cooking until the spinach wilts.
Red Wine Cream Sauce
Prepare the Sauce
In the same pot used for the short ribs, add red wine and simmer until reduced by half, about 10 minutes. Stir in heavy cream and Parmesan cheese, cooking until the sauce thickens, about 5 minutes.
Combine and Serve
Mix Everything Together
Combine the cooked pasta, shredded short rib, sautéed mushrooms, spinach, and sun-dried tomatoes into the pot with the red wine cream sauce. Stir until well coated.
Serve
Serve hot, garnished with additional Parmesan cheese if desired.
